Why a Reliable Knotter is Key for Small Baling
A baler’s knotter system might seem like a small component, but its performance has an outsized impact on your entire haying operation. On a small farm, efficiency isn’t about speed; it’s about minimizing downtime and waste. Every time a knot fails, you’re forced to stop, climb down from the tractor, clear the chamber, and re-feed the twine, all while your window for good baling weather might be closing.
This isn’t just an inconvenience; it’s a direct loss of resources. The loose hay has to be raked back into a windrow, and you’ve lost the time and fuel it took to make that bale. Furthermore, a poorly tied bale that comes apart in the barn is more than a mess. It represents lost winter feed for your animals, wasted bedding, or a lower-quality product you can’t sell to a customer who expects tight, uniform bales.
A dependable knotter provides peace of mind. It allows you to focus on driving straight and monitoring the pickup, rather than constantly looking over your shoulder waiting for the next failure. For the hobby farmer, who often bales alone and in short windows of time after a day job, that reliability is the difference between a smooth, satisfying job and a day of pure frustration. New Holland Hayliner Knotter: The Gold Standard
For decades, the New Holland knotter has been the benchmark against which all others are measured, and for good reason. Its design is fundamentally sound, tying a consistent and tight knot when properly adjusted. Found on countless older Hayliner models that are staples of small farms, this system is a testament to a design that simply works.
The key to the New Holland system is its precision. It requires careful adjustment of the billhook tension and twine disc timing, but once dialed in, it is remarkably consistent across a range of hay conditions, from light grass to heavy alfalfa. This is the knotter for the farmer who appreciates mechanical systems and is willing to spend a little time with a wrench and a feeler gauge to learn its nuances. It rewards that effort with season after season of dependable service.
If you’re buying a used baler, a well-maintained New Holland with its original knotters is often one of the safest bets you can make. It’s not the fastest or the most technologically advanced, but its reliability is legendary. For the hobby farmer who values proven performance over bells and whistles, the Hayliner knotter is the undisputed gold standard.
John Deere 348 Series Knotter for Durability
When you think of John Deere equipment, you think of heavy-duty construction, and the knotter system on their popular square balers is no exception. The knotters used on models like the 348 are built to withstand the high stress of baling dense, heavy material. They are engineered with robust components that resist wear and tear, even after thousands of bales.
This system is ideal for the farmer who regularly puts up tough crops like first-cutting alfalfa, dense straw, or slightly damp haylage. Where other knotters might struggle with the high tension required to pack these materials tightly, the John Deere system maintains its timing and strength. The result is fewer missed knots when the baler is working its hardest.
The tradeoff for this durability is sometimes a slightly more complex system to troubleshoot than simpler designs. However, for the operator who needs to make consistently heavy bales without worrying about knotter frame flex or component failure, the John Deere knotter is the right choice. It’s built for power and endurance.
Massey Ferguson 1800 Series Inline Knotter
The Massey Ferguson 1800 series introduced many small-scale farmers to the benefits of an inline baler, where the hay is fed directly through the center of the machine. This design produces incredibly dense and perfectly shaped bales, and the knotter system is a crucial part of that equation. The Hesston-designed knotters on these machines are known for their speed and consistency, which is essential for keeping up with the baler’s high capacity.
Because inline balers pack hay so evenly, the knotter doesn’t have to struggle with the lopsided pressure often found in a side-fed baler. This leads to more uniform tension on the twine and a more reliable tying cycle. These knotters are designed for high-volume work, tying thousands of knots without needing constant readjustment.
If you sell hay to discerning customers, particularly in the horse market, the perfect "bricks" produced by an inline baler are a major selling point. The Massey Ferguson 1800 series knotter is for the producer focused on bale quality and density. It’s the choice for those who see baling not just as preserving feed, but as creating a premium product.
Freeman 1592 Knotter: Simple and Robust Design
Freeman balers have a loyal following, especially among those who value mechanical simplicity and field serviceability. The knotter system on a model like the 1592 embodies this philosophy. It’s a straightforward, robust design with fewer moving parts than some of its more complex competitors, making it easier for the owner-operator to understand, adjust, and repair.
This knotter is a workhorse, designed for reliability in a wide range of conditions without needing constant fine-tuning. Its simplicity means there are fewer things that can go wrong. When a problem does arise, the cause is often easier to diagnose and fix with basic hand tools, which is a significant advantage when you’re alone in the field.
The Freeman knotter is the perfect match for the hands-on farmer who does their own maintenance and values function over form. It might not have the high-speed capabilities of newer designs, but its rugged construction and ease of repair make it an incredibly dependable partner for getting the hay in the barn, year after year.
Case IH SBX Series Knotter: Consistent Tying
The knotters on the Case IH SBX series of small square balers are praised for their out-of-the-box consistency. These systems are engineered to provide a wide tolerance for different twine types and crop conditions, meaning you spend less time making adjustments and more time baling. They are known for their reliable twine finger and billhook action, which securely holds the twine throughout the tying cycle.
This consistency is a major benefit for hobby farmers who may be baling a variety of crops—from fine grass hay in the spring to coarse oat straw in the summer. The ability to switch between conditions without having to completely retune the knotter is a significant time-saver. The system is designed to produce a tight, well-formed knot every time, reducing the chances of a "slip" knot that pulls apart under pressure.
If your priority is minimizing fuss and maximizing baling time, the Case IH knotter is a fantastic option. It’s for the operator who wants a reliable system that performs consistently across the entire season with minimal intervention. This is the knotter for predictable, dependable performance.
Hesston by MF Knotter for High-Capacity Baling
Hesston has long been a leader in hay tool innovation, and their knotter systems are a core reason why. The knotters found on many Hesston-built balers (including many modern Massey Ferguson models) are designed for high-capacity, high-speed operation. They feature a gear-driven design that ensures precise, repeatable timing even when the plunger is operating at maximum strokes per minute.
This system is built for operators who need to bale a lot of hay in a short amount of time. The components are hardened and designed for longevity under constant, heavy use. The knotter’s ability to maintain its timing at high speeds means you can push the baler to its full capacity without worrying about an increase in missed ties, a common issue with older, slower systems.
While a hobby farmer may not always need this level of throughput, it’s invaluable when trying to beat an incoming rainstorm or when baling a heavy crop. For the small farmer with a lot of acres to cover, or for someone who does custom baling work, the Hesston knotter provides the speed and reliability needed to get the job done fast and right.
A&I Products Knotter Stack: Aftermarket Value
For many hobby farmers running older, well-loved balers, finding original equipment manufacturer (OEM) parts can be difficult and expensive. This is where aftermarket solutions like the knotter stacks from A&I Products become essential. They offer complete, pre-assembled knotter units designed to be direct replacements for a wide variety of baler models from John Deere, New Holland, and others.
The primary advantage here is value and accessibility. You can often replace an entire worn-out knotter assembly for a fraction of the cost of OEM parts, breathing new life into an otherwise solid machine. This makes it possible to keep a reliable old baler in the field instead of facing the major expense of a new one. These aftermarket units are built to meet or exceed original specifications, providing reliable tying performance.
This is the solution for the budget-conscious farmer or the owner of an "orphan" baler model with poor parts support. It’s a practical, cost-effective way to solve chronic knotter problems. While it may require some careful model matching to ensure a perfect fit, an A&I knotter stack is the smartest investment you can make in an older machine with a good frame and plunger.
Knotter Maintenance Tips to Prevent Twine Snaps
Even the best knotter will fail if it’s not properly maintained. Twine breakage and missed knots are often symptoms of neglect, not poor design. Integrating a few simple checks into your routine can prevent the vast majority of tying problems and keep you baling smoothly.
First, cleanliness is critical. Before each use, use compressed air or a brush to blow all the chaff, dust, and old twine fragments out of the knotter assembly. Debris can interfere with the precise movement of the billhook, twine discs, and knife arm. Pay special attention to the area around the billhook and the twine knife, as buildup here is a common cause of problems.
Second, perform regular inspections of key components.
- Twine Knife: Make sure the knife is sharp. A dull knife will fray the twine instead of cutting it cleanly, leading to weak knots or failures to strip the knot from the billhook.
- Billhook Tension: Check the tension on the billhook tongue. If it’s too loose, it won’t hold the knot securely; if it’s too tight, the knot won’t strip off properly. This is a simple adjustment with a spring or bolt on most models.
- Twine Disc Timing: Ensure the twine discs are timed correctly to grab the twine at the right moment. Your baler’s manual is the best guide for this critical adjustment.
- Use Quality Twine: Don’t cheap out on twine. Old, brittle, or inconsistent-diameter twine is a primary cause of breakage. Stick with a reputable brand and store it in a dry place away from sunlight.
Choosing the Right Knotter for Your Baler Model
The "best" knotter is ultimately the one that works reliably on your machine and is suited to your specific needs. If you’re buying a used baler, the knotter system it comes with is a major factor in the decision. A baler with a well-known, well-supported knotter like a New Holland or John Deere is often a safer long-term investment due to parts availability.
If you’re facing issues with your current baler, the decision is whether to repair or replace the existing knotters. For common models, individual parts are readily available. However, if you have multiple worn components or an older, unsupported model, a complete aftermarket knotter stack from a company like A&I Products is often the most economical and effective solution.
Consider your primary crops and baling style. If you exclusively bale light grass hay, a simple, robust system like a Freeman might be all you need. If you’re pushing dense, heavy bales for the horse market, the durability of a John Deere or the precision of a Massey Ferguson inline system is a better fit. The right choice balances cost, parts availability, and the specific demands you place on your equipment.
